## Objective
|
||||
|
||||
Verify non-sequential reads from deterministic offsets in an LZ4-compressed
|
||||
file and compare every returned byte with the source. `$RANDOM` and timing-only
|
||||
checks are not evidence of data correctness.

## FreeBSD Procedure
|
||||
|
||||
```sh
|
||||
mkdir "$work/mnt"
|
||||
unit=$(mdconfig -a -t vnode -f "$work/fixtures/valid-lz4.erofs")
|
||||
mount -t erofs -o ro "/dev/$unit" "$work/mnt"
|
||||
size=$(stat -f %z "$work/fixtures/source/compressed.bin")
|
||||
test "$size" -gt 1052672
|
||||
|
||||
index=0
|
||||
for offset in 0 4096 65536 1048576 $((size - 4096)); do
|
||||
"$work/read_probe" pread "$work/mnt/compressed.bin" \
|
||||
"$offset" 4096 "$work/guest-$index.bin"
|
||||
"$work/read_probe" pread "$work/fixtures/source/compressed.bin" \
|
||||
"$offset" 4096 "$work/source-$index.bin"
|
||||
cmp "$work/source-$index.bin" "$work/guest-$index.bin"
|
||||
index=$((index + 1))
|
||||
done
|
||||
|
||||
umount "$work/mnt"
|
||||
mdconfig -d -u "${unit#md}"
|
||||
```
|
||||
|
||||
## Expected Results
|
||||
|
||||
All five fixed reads, including the final 4 KiB of the file, return exactly
|
||||
4096 bytes and compare equal to their corresponding source ranges. No
|
||||
performance ordering is asserted.
